Spider-Man: Brand New Day Soars Again at Box Office

In its third weekend, Spider-Man: Brand New Day continues to dominate the box office, raking in an impressive $19 million on Friday alone. By the end of the weekend, the superhero film is projected to reach a staggering $67 million, marking its third consecutive week at the top. With Tom Holland and Zendaya leading the cast, the movie is on track for a remarkable North American total of $782.8 million within just 17 days, placing it fifth on the all-time domestic list.

In a bid to challenge Spider-Man's reign, Warner Bros. released The End of Oak Street, which earned $8.1 million on Friday, including previews. This dinosaur-themed flick, starring Anne Hathaway and Ewan McGregor, is expected to land around $20 million for its opening weekend. Critics have given it a decent 85 percent approval rating on Rotten Tomatoes, although audiences rated it a B CinemaScore.

Meanwhile, PAW Patrol: The Dino Movie is also in the mix, grossing $7.3 million on Friday and aiming for a similar $20 million debut. With an A CinemaScore from audiences, it features a star-studded voice cast, including Jennifer Hudson and Snoop Dogg. It has already collected $38.3 million internationally, indicating strong appeal across various markets.
